Singer Roland Kaiser isn't one to let the spotlight linger after a performance, as he revealed to the German Press Agency in Hamburg. "After greeting thousands of fans, it takes me just a couple of minutes to blend back into the crowd," Roland said, revealing his humble demeanor. He leaves the stage, refusing to let applause follow him to the dressing room, and prefers keeping his performing prowess confined to his work.

Regarding his personal life, he's not one to brag about his accomplishments. "My job is my job, and I thoroughly enjoy it," he shared. "But once I step off the stage, I'm not a star anymore; I'm just another person." This mindset may stem from his role as a father. Roland is the proud dad to three adults.

Roland is currently touring Germany, Switzerland, and Austria, celebrating the "RK50 - 50 Years - 50 Hits - The Great Tour for the 50th Stage Anniversary". He's stepping onto a new platform for his shows, engaging in performances at stadiums. His next stop, on Saturday, will be the second concert of the tour in Oberhof.
